Poison Oak Removal Questions
What is poison oak removal? Poison oak removal involves safely eliminating the plant from outdoor spaces to reduce exposure and prevent skin irritation.
When should poison oak be removed? Removal is recommended when poison oak is found in areas accessible to people or pets, especially before outdoor activities or landscaping.
What are common methods of poison oak removal? Methods include physical removal through cutting and digging, along with applying targeted herbicides to eliminate the plants.
